PhysicalNominal ValueUnitTest Method
Specific Gravity 1.21g/cm³ASTM D792
Molding Shrinkage - Flow (3.20 mm)0.50 to 1.0%ASTM D955
Water Absorption (24 hr)1.2%ASTM D570
HardnessNominal ValueUnitTest Method
Rockwell Hardness (R-Scale)115ASTM D785
MechanicalNominal ValueUnitTest Method
Tensile Strength 1(Break, 3.20 mm)98.1MPaASTM D638
Tensile Elongation 2(Break, 3.20 mm)4.5%ASTM D638
Flexural Modulus 3(6.40 mm)3920MPaASTM D790
Flexural Strength 4(Yield, 6.40 mm)137MPaASTM D790
ImpactNominal ValueUnitTest Method
Notched Izod Impact ASTM D256
    -30°C, 6.40 mm 59J/m
    23°C, 6.40 mm 140J/m
ThermalNominal ValueUnitTest Method
Deflection Temperature Under Load (1.8 MPa, Unannealed, 6.40 mm)200°CASTM D648
Peak Melting Temperature 220°CASTM D3418
CLTE - Flow 3.6E-5cm/cm/°CASTM D696
ElectricalNominal ValueUnitTest Method
Volume Resistivity 1.0E+16ohms·cmASTM D257
Dielectric Strength (1.00 mm)21kV/mmASTM D149
Dielectric Constant (1 MHz)3.50ASTM D150
Arc Resistance 180secASTM D495
InjectionNominal ValueUnit
Drying Temperature 80.0 to 100°C
Drying Time 4.0 to 5.0hr
Suggested Max Moisture 0.10%
Rear Temperature 250 to 270°C
Middle Temperature 260 to 285°C
Front Temperature 260 to 290°C
Nozzle Temperature 260 to 290°C
Processing (Melt) Temp 260 to 280°C
Mold Temperature 80.0 to 100°C
Back Pressure 50.981 to 2.94MPa
Screw Speed 60 to 150rpm
